What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ues for drivers in the Maryland Line area?

Given the rural roads and seasonal temperature swings, common issues include suspension wear from uneven surfaces, battery failures due to extreme heat and cold, and increased brake wear. For specific models like the Chevrolet Equinox or Silverado, local technicians often address electrical glitches and 4WD system maintenance.

When should I seek service for my Chevrolet's check engine light around Maryland Line?

Seek service immediately if the light is flashing or if you notice performance loss, as this could indicate a serious issue damaging to the catalytic converter. For a steady light, schedule a diagnostic scan promptly, as it could relate to the emissions system or oxygen sensors, which are crucial for state inspection.

Are repair costs for Chevrolets higher at dealerships versus independent shops in Maryland Line?

Typically, dealerships in nearby areas like Hunt Valley or Bel Air have higher labor rates than a qualified independent shop in Maryland Line. However, for complex computer or warranty work, a dealership's specialized expertise may be necessary, so always compare estimates and the shop's specific experience with your model.

What local factors in Maryland Line should I consider for Chevrolet maintenance?

The proximity to agricultural areas and gravel/dirt roads means more frequent air filter and cabin filter changes to manage dust and pollen. Also, preparing your cooling system and battery for humid summers and cold winters is essential to prevent breakdowns on less-traveled local roads.
